How to Make chicken noodle casserole
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:
Step 1: Preheat Your Oven
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Spray a large baking dish with nonstick cooking spray to prevent sticking.
Step 2: Cook the Noodles
In a large pot of boiling salted water, cook the egg noodles according to package instructions until al dente. Drain them well and set aside.
Step 3: Prepare the Chicken
In a skillet over medium heat, cook diced boneless skinless chicken breasts until they are golden brown and cooked through—approximately 7-10 minutes.
Step 4: Combine Ingredients
In a mixing bowl, combine cooked noodles, cooked chicken, cream of chicken soup, shredded cheese, and any optional vegetables. Stir until everything is well coated.
Step 5: Transfer Mixture
Transfer the mixture into your prepared baking dish evenly spread it out with a spatula.
Step 6: Bake
Bake in preheated oven for about 30 minutes until bubbly and golden on top. For an extra crispy topping, broil for an additional few minutes.

Mistakes to avoid
- Using the wrong type of chicken: When making chicken noodle casserole, it’s essential to select the right type of chicken. Many people opt for pre-cooked or rotisserie chicken, which can work, but using raw chicken allows for better flavor infusion during cooking. Ensure that you dice the chicken into even pieces for uniform cooking. If not cooked properly, some pieces may remain undercooked while others become dry. Always check that your ch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F for safety and optimal taste.
- Overcooking the noodles: A common mistake is overcooking the noodles before adding them to the casserole. Pre-cooking them until they are fully soft can lead to mushy noodles once baked. Instead, cook them just until al dente, as they will continue to soften while baking in the casserole. This helps maintain the perfect texture and prevents your dish from becoming a soggy mess.
- Ignoring seasoning: Seasoning is crucial in any casserole, especially with chicken noodle casserole. Some cooks make the mistake of under-seasoning their ingredients. Always taste your mixture before baking and adjust seasoning accordingly. A lack of salt, pepper, and herbs can lead to a bland dish that doesn’t showcase the flavors you intended. Experiment with garlic powder, onion powder, or fresh herbs like thyme or parsley for an extra flavor boost.

Can I make chicken noodle casserole in advance?
Yes! One of the best aspects of chicken noodle casserole is its make-ahead capability. Prepare the casserole up to the baking stage, cover it tightly with plastic wrap or foil, and refrigerate. You can store it in the fridge for up to 24 hours before baking. When you’re ready to eat, simply remove it from the refrigerator and allow it to sit at room temperature for about 30 minutes before popping it into the oven. This way, you save time on busy days while still serving a delicious homemade meal.
Is chicken noodle casserole healthy?
While chicken noodle casserole can be comforting and filling, its healthiness largely depends on the ingredients used. Opting for whole-grain noodles instead of regular egg noodles can increase fiber content. Using low-fat cream of chicken soup or making your own can reduce calories and fat levels significantly. Adding plenty of vegetables not only boosts nutrition but also enhances flavor. Balancing portions is key; enjoy this dish as part of a diverse diet for optimal health benefits.
How do I store leftovers of chicken noodle casserole?
Storing leftovers from your chicken noodle casserole is easy! Allow it to c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. You can keep it in the refrigerator for up to three days. If you want to extend its shelf life further, consider freezing portions in freezer-safe containers or bags; it should last up to three months when frozen. To reheat, simply thaw overnight in the fridge if frozen and warm it in the oven or microwave until heated through.
